Catalog description
This course continues development of professional knowledge and behaviors by addressing advocacy, funding of OT services, reimbursement, and global health. Students explore healthcare and legislative policies, reform, and all levels of advocacy are explored. Concepts of global health such as ethical responses during disasters in health care, OT's acute and long-term role in interprofessional disaster- response teams, and promoting health and well-being globally are addressed. Students become more familiar with promoting and advocating for occupational therapy to advance the profession and enhance client care.
